Вордпресс - Операције базе података

Преглед садржаја
Много пута у оквиру изабране путање потребно је прилагодити табеле, креирати нове, како би се испунили захтеви или можда стварамо додатак са много функционалности. Постоји доста опција које нас могу довести до тога да морамо извршити различите врсте сложених операција над базама података у нашој инсталацији Вордпресс.
Метод Гет_ров ()
Већ знамо да ако уметнемо запис, то је зато што ћемо му у неком тренутку вероватно морати приступити, осим ако се ради о некој табели одржавања, међутим претпоставићемо да морамо да добијемо неке записе из наше базе података из Вордпресс, за ово ћемо користити методу гет_ров ()Ово може вратити резултате као објект или као низ, било нумерички или асоцијативни; Погледајмо пример кода на следећој слици како га можемо користити.

Овај једноставан пример говори нам да ћемо све податке донети из табеле вп_постс, где вп_ може бити још један префикс који смо успоставили приликом инсталације Вордпресс и са честицом $ впдб-> добијамо тачан префикс, информације које ћемо извући су оне повезане са ИД пољем чија је вредност 1, тада можемо приступити као да је својство објекта са $ тхепост-> пост_титле; како можемо видети ову имплементацију је прилично једноставно, али веома моћно.
Сада, ако желимо да добијемо више колона, најбоље је користити функцију гет_ресултс (); је ако је спреман за складиштење више од једног записа података, да видимо на следећој слици како се користи:

Оно што овај последњи упит ради је да нам донесе све постове чији је пост_статус једнак 'објави', у овом случају уместо да одаберемо све вредности са * користимо поља која ћемо посебно унети, овај пут нам је потребно ИД и пост_титле; онда можемо проћи кроз наш објекат са предзнаком од ПХП а пољима записа можемо приступити као да су својства објекта.
Метод Гет_инсерт ()
Вордпресс Овом методом нуди нам могућност уклањања сирових упита у базу података ради уметања, чиме се повећава сигурност на њој, да бисмо користили ову методу, морамо слиједити сљедећу структуру:
$ впдб-> уметни ($ табле, $ дата);

$ табле је назив табеле или табеле у које ћемо уметнути податке, а $ дата садржи податке и називе поља. Погледајмо пример како можемо да направимо уметање:
 инсерт ($ впдб-> ми_цустом_табле, арраи ('фиелд_оне' => $ неввалуеоне, 'фиелд_тво' => $ неввалуетво)); ?> вар13 -> 

Као што видимо, прво што смо урадили је креирање две променљиве које би ускладиштиле садржај који желимо да уметнемо, а затим зовемо методу инсерт () прослеђивање табеле као првог параметра, а затим низ са пољима и подацима које свако мора да претпостави. Након овог процеса и ако је ова операција успешна у извођењу, одговарајуће уметање се врши у базу података.Да ли вам се допао и помогао овај водич?Можете наградити аутора притиском на ово дугме да бисте му дали позитиван поен

Ви ће помоћи развој сајта, дељење страницу са пријатељима

wave wave wave wave wave